The Orpheus team was formed to own a very important aspect of Cloudflare's systems: enable more reliable network connectivity for Cloudflare’s products than the Internet itself provides.

Almost all products in Cloudflare’s portfolio are or will be powered by Orpheus technology, including CDN, Spectrum, Magic Transit, Stream, Workers, Workers AI, R2, WARP, and more. As a member of the Orpheus team, you’ll be a key technical contributor to the cutting edge network software infrastructure used by those products.

You will work closely with various Engineering teams to translate their requirements into new capabilities on the platform. Likewise you will partner with Network Engineering and SRE to ensure that the technology makes the best use of Cloudflare's world-class edge network.

You will participate in all stages of the software development lifecycle, from designing and documenting systems, to writing code and automated tests, to planning, managing, and monitoring production software deployments. You will work with a wide range of technologies and programming languages, including Rust, Go, Linux networking, ClickHouse, PostgreSQL, Grafana, Kubernetes, and more.

Engineering teams at Cloudflare operate a Run What You Build model, including ours. We are responsible for the health of our system and participate in our team's on-call rotation as part of operational responsibilities.

Our System

  • Cloud Native, deployed in Kubernetes on AWS infrastructure
  • Written in .NET, API First (REST) approach with thin UI client
  • Written in microservices, DDD, CQRS, Event Based, Saga Pattern for Distributed Transactions
  • Multi-tenant and multi-region (US, EU, China, APAC, Middle East deployed regions)
  • Green field development, with less than 5 years old code, started from scratch in .NET Core
